Description

Antiparasitic agent-25 (Compounds 11) is an orally active antiparasitic agent. Antiparasitic agent-25 inhibits both parasite invasion and replication ability and has irreversible action against Toxoplasma gondii, significantly reducing the replication rate of Toxoplasma gondii with an IC50 value of 6.33 μM, and demonstrates low cytotoxicity with a CC50 value of 285 μM[1].

IC50 & Target

IC50: 6.33 μM (Toxoplasma gondii)[1]

In Vitro

Antiparasitic agent-25 (10 μM, 24-72 h) reveals irreversible action of against Toxoplasma gondii[1].
Antiparasitic agent-25 (10 μM; 30 min) significantly cut down the number of invaded parasites, indicating it can inhibit the invasion of parasites into host cells[1].
Antiparasitic agent-25 (10 μM, 24 h) constrains the replication of the majority of tachyzoites to 0-1 cycles, manifesting a prevalence of vacuoles sized for accommodating only one or two tachyzoites[1].

In Vivo

Antiparasitic agent-25 (50 mg/kg; p.o.; twice daily for 5 days) reduces parasite numbers, statistically significantly extends the median survival time, but insufficient to completely suppress the growth of parasites in vivo, leading to continued infection and consequently high mortality rates among infected mice[1].

Animal Model: Female Kunming mice (eight-nine weeks old) (Inoculated with 1 × 103 tachyzoites of the RH strain via intraperitoneal (ip) injection.)[1]
Dosage: 50 mg/kg (Dissolved in PBS including 25% PEG-400 and 5% DMSO)
Administration: Oral gavage (p.o.); twice daily for 5 days
Result: Reduced parasite numbers, statistically significantly extended the median survival time, but insufficient to completely suppress the growth of parasites in vivo, leading to continued infection and consequently high mortality rates among infected mice.
